| Challenge: | 103 peer-reviewed publications on hallucination in large language models (LLMs) are characterized by a lack of agreement with the term ‘hallucination’ in the field of NLP. |
| Approach: | They examine 103 peer-reviewed publications on hallucination in large language models (LLMs) and conduct a survey with 171 practitioners from the field of NLP and AI to capture varying perspectives on halllucination. |
| Outcome: | The findings highlight the need for explicit definitions and frameworks outlining hallucination within NLP and highlight potential challenges. |
